It is with great sadness that we, the family, announce the passing of our Mom, Iris Marie (Harrietha) Jones, on Saturday, March 22, 2025, at the Cape Breton Regional Hospital, surrounded by her loving family.
Born in Mill Creek on May 9, 1945, Iris was the daughter of the late John Carl and Annie Grace (Marsh) Harrietha. Mom was married to Dad for 53 years. Iris started working at the British Canadian Cooperative in Sydney Mines. Together with her husband, Joe, she owned and operated Iris’s Restaurant in Bras d’Or. In her later years, until her retirement, she worked for Canada Post. Mom loved to spend time with her friends playing cards. She loved to cook and bake her delicious coconut cream pies for all to enjoy. She felt very fortunate to have a great friend in Heather MacNeil, who was always there for her.
Mom is survived by her children, Liam (Dianne) Jones Port Colburne, Lisa Macdonald (Peter) Halifax, Gail Jessome Halifax, Paul Jones Edmonton, and Carl Jones Bras d’Or.
Mom is survived by her six grandchildren, Kelly Jones (Lindsey), Nicole Jessome, Matthew Jessome, Brandon Macdonald, and Holly and Alicia Jones.
Mom was predeceased by her husband Joseph (Joe) Jones and son-in-law Raymond Jessome. Mom was the last surviving member of her immediate family, predeceased by her brothers Carl Harrietha, Russell Harrietha, Reg (Farmer) Harrietha, and sisters Sue Harrietha and Nancy Kelsie.
In accordance with Mom’s wishes, cremation has taken place. A funeral service will be held on Wednesday, March 26th, 2025, at 10:30 am at St. Joseph’s Catholic Parish Church Bras d'Or
